<p class="MsoNormal">The is a very brief shot of the gas flame
at about 1:25. That is the Model 4 crossdraft coal gasifier
flame. Note the colour. When the cover is on, it burns with
less disturbance but that is hard to show without a glass
cover.<o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al"><o:p> </o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al">There is also a good view towards the end
of a TLUD gasifier which has a burn time of about 9 hours. The
only fuel provided to schools is a very poor quality ‘Aine
coal’ which is about 50% rock. It looks like black rock to
start and white rock after burning. That TLUD is able to burn
it properly provided there is sufficient draft, which means a
5m chimney. Achieving that was quite difficult, I admit and
was only solve on literally the last day of the trip in
November.<o:p></o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al"><o:p> </o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al">There are two videos now but I think the
other one has been referenced here before. The new one is
combined. A total of 91 homes were involved in the pilot in
the two countries. The PM reduction numbers mentioned are
modest, the true figures for the Models 4 and 5 coal stove are
closer to 99.9%.<o:p></o:p></p>
